Karen and Craig at the Harding Allen Estate









Last weekend we got to launch into spring with not only a gorgeous, warm day, but with a wedding that rivaled all that mother nature served up. We spent the weekend at The Harding Allen Estate, in Barre Massachusetts capturing the wedding of Craig and Karen. Tim arrived the night before in hopes of catching a little of the morning "fun run" put on by the bride. I was travelling from a decidedly farther origin, flying in from a Mexican photographic adventure with not much time to spare. Due to some surgical planning, some good luck and perhaps a few karma chips cashed in, I put together a chaotic mix of planes, buses, and rental cars to show up at the event. With a half hour to spare I had time to walk the grounds, meet all the major players, and fall into a comfortable rhythm with the Groom and his men. With Tim covering all that happened with the ladies, and me with the guys, we were both having a blast utilizing the landscape and grounds of this wonderful estate. Craig and Karen were not only laid back and a lot of fun to work with, they were also up for pretty much anything we could toss at them. We shot separately for two hours before the wedding, utilizing every inch of the place and still managing to keep the bride and groom from seeing each other. The effort of keeping them apart while still shooting both sides of the party and using each part of the grounds was well worth it when Craig saw Karen pass through the arch into the garden. He lit up into the most pure smile imaginable.
The day was idyllic on every level. After it was over, all the guests had departed to a parade of sparklers, and we had enjoyed a few quiet moments with Craig and Karen in the soft light surrounding the reflecting pool , we then joined the families and wedding party(as we were staying at the Estate), kicked off our shoes, and enjoyed a cold beer as we listened to Buffett(the groom is a full-on parrot head) sing the praises of the Carribean life that the couple was headed to on their honeymoon.
The morning came too quickly and with it came the other half of what is considered a typical New England spring day. The gray and drizzle didn't deter these guys. Karen donned a "throw away" dress we brought for her and we headed out for a brief trash the dress session with them. They even volunteered to jump into the rather chilly water of the reflecting pool. Okay, so maybe they eased in....
As we rode home to Maine we chatted about how much fun these two were, how great it is when a couple gives us the time and energy to get beyond the norm, and how most of all we couldn't wait to see the images. These are just a tiny sampling of our "favorites".
